πŸ₯˜ Ingredients

10 items
  • 3 large Russet potatoes
  • 2 tablespoons Ol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on Salt
  • 0.5 teaspoon Black pepper
  • 0.5 teaspoon Paprika
  • 0.5 teaspoon Garlic powder
  • 1 cup Shredded sharp cheddar cheese
  • 4 slices Cooked and crumbled bacon
  • 0.5 cup Sour cream
  • 2 tablespoons Chopped green onions

πŸ“ Instructions

10 steps
1

Preheat your oven to 400Β°F (200Β°C) and line a large baking sheet with parchment paper or foil for easier cleanup.

2

Wash the potatoes thoroughly and slice them into 1/4-inch-thick rounds. Discard the ends.

3

Place the potato slices into a large mixing bowl. Add olive oil, salt, black pepper, paprika, and garlic powder. Toss well to ensure the slices are evenly coated.

4

Arrange the potato slices in a single layer on the prepared baking sheet, leaving space between each slice.

5

Bake in the preheated oven for 25 minutes, flipping the slices halfway through cooking to ensure they brown evenly on both sides.

6

Remove the baking sheet from the oven and sprinkle the cheddar cheese and crumbled bacon evenly over the potato slices.

7

Return the baking sheet to the oven and bake for an additional 10-15 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and bubbly.

8

Remove from the oven and let the slices cool for a few minutes.

9

Transfer the potato slices to a serving platter. Top each slice with a dollop of sour cream and sprinkle with chopped green onions.

10

Serve warm and enjoy!
